数据库英文词汇解析:异常、设计与应用

需积分: 0 2 下载量 178 浏览量 更新于2024-08-05 收藏 193KB PDF 举报
"本文档提供了一些数据库领域的核心概念和术语,包括访问方法、异常、应用程序设计、属性等,旨在帮助读者理解和掌握数据库设计的基础知识。" 在数据库领域,"访问方法"(Access method)指的是数据如何被存储和检索,这涉及到索引、排序和查询优化等方面,是数据库性能的关键因素。"异常"(Anomalies)通常指的是在数据库设计中可能出现的问题,如更新异常,它可能导致数据不一致,需要通过规范化处理来避免。 "应用程序设计"(Application design)是数据库生命周期中的重要环节,包括规划用户界面、创建与数据库交互的逻辑以及确保应用程序符合业务需求。"别名"(Alias)允许我们为数据库对象如表或列提供替代名称,提高代码的可读性和灵活性。 "备用键"(Alternate keys)在实体关系模型中是指除了主键之外,能够唯一标识实体的其他候选键。"属性"(Attribute)在关系模型中指的是表格中的列,在ER模型中则是实体或关系的特性。 "属性继承"(Attribute inheritance)是面向对象设计中的概念,但在数据库设计中也有应用,子类可以继承超类的属性,同时具有自己的特有属性。"基本表"(Base table)是数据库中实际存储数据的表。 "二元关系"(Binary relationship)在ER模型中描述了两个实体之间的关联,如"panchHasStaff"表示员工与部门之间的关系。"自底向上方法"(Bottom-up approach)是一种数据库设计策略,从最小的组件开始构建,逐步整合成整个系统。 "业务规则"(Business rules)是用户或管理员定义的,影响数据处理和验证的规则。"候选键"(Candidate key)是能唯一标识实体的属性集合,它可能包含最少的列。 "基数"(Cardinality)描述了实体间关系的数量,例如一对一、一对多或多对多。"集中化方法"(Centralized approach)在数据库设计中意味着整合所有用户需求来创建一个统一的应用程序。 "深坑陷阱"(Chasm trap)是一个设计陷阱,可能出现在假设实体间有联系,但实际上并不存在的情况。"客户端"(Client)是请求服务器服务的软件,如数据库查询。"群集字段"(Clustering field)用于按特定字段对记录进行分组,以优化查询效率。 这些术语和概念构成了数据库设计和管理的基础,理解它们对于有效地构建和维护数据库至关重要。在实践中,根据具体场景灵活运用这些知识,可以优化数据库性能,确保数据一致性,并提高整体系统的效率。